iOS Team Lead, Offensive Security Researcher

GlobalPosted 1 months ago
Full-timeremote

Job Description

We are seeking an accomplished and collaborative Team Lead to guide an advanced offensive security research team. You will drive research strategy, foster knowledge sharing, mentor talented security researchers, and ensure the team remains at the forefront of vulnerability discovery and exploit development across cutting-edge platforms.

Key Responsibilities

Leadership & Team Management

  • Lead a high-performing team of offensive security researchers; conduct regular 1-on-1 video check-ins to support professional development and team wellbeing.

  • Attend leadership meetings to coordinate cross-team initiatives and align priorities.

  • Maintain regular and transparent communication through weekly and event-driven status updates, addressing achievements, challenges, team needs, and research progress.

  • Create a collaborative, innovative, and supportive team environment by encouraging documentation, knowledge sharing, and technical presentations.

  • Organize and facilitate engaging weekly team calls focused on resource sharing, brainstorming research directions, and collaboratively solving technical challenges.

  • Set technical priorities for the team, balancing current research objectives with exploration into new technologies and attack surfaces.

  • Mentor junior researchers and new hires, ensuring strong onboarding, continuous learning, and professional growth.

  • Lead technical recruitment activities, including interviewing and evaluating candidates.

  • Manage performance reviews, give ongoing constructive feedback, recommend ratings and bonuses, and communicate outcomes to leadership.

  • Plan and manage team budget, including travel, training, and conference opportunities.

Technical Research Oversight

  • Oversee and guide the identification, analysis, and exploitation of vulnerabilities across modern operating systems, kernel components, and complex software ecosystems.

  • Direct efforts in reverse engineering, proof-of-concept exploit development, and bypassing advanced security mitigations.

  • Ensure research aligns with the latest trends in attack techniques, mitigations, and emerging technologies.

  • Encourage publication of impactful research and proactive adaptation to software and security updates in the wider industry landscape.

Requirements

  • Proven experience leading or mentoring technical teams in offensive security or vulnerability research.

  • Extensive track record of iOS vulnerability research and exploitation on modern devices and chipsets.

  • Strong understanding of recent iOS mitigations such as PAC, SPTM, MIE, etc

  • Advanced expertise in vulnerability discovery, reverse engineering, and exploit development within a iOS operating system or platform.

  • Strong programming skills in languages such as C, C++, and low-level assembly.

  • Familiarity with industry-standard toolsets for reverse engineering and debugging.

  • Demonstrated history of impactful security research (e.g., advisories, CVEs, publications).

  • Excellent organizational, communication, and team-building skills.
